Understanding Irregular Menstrual Cycles

What is Irregular Menstruation?

Irregular menstrual cycles deviate from the typical 28-day cycle, with variations in cycle length, flow, or skipped periods. While it can be unsettling, understanding the reasons behind irregularity can bring a sense of empowerment.

Unveiling the Reasons

1. Hormonal Harmony

Hormones orchestrate the menstrual symphony, and imbalances can lead to irregular cycles. Understanding the delicate interplay of estrogen and progesterone brought clarity and a foundation for proactive self-care.

2. Lifestyle Impact

Stress, diet, and lifestyle choices emerged as silent conductors influencing the menstrual orchestra. Implementing stress-reducing activities and adopting a nourishing lifestyle became anchors in finding stability.

Coping Strategies

1. Cycle Tracking

Keeping a menstrual diary transformed the irregularity puzzle into a pattern. Tracking symptoms, emotions, and cycle lengths provided valuable insights into my body's unique rhythm.

Seeking Professional Guidance

1. Gynecological Consultation

Consulting a gynecologist was a pivotal step. Professional guidance helped rule out underlying health issues and provided tailored recommendations for managing irregularities.

2. Birth Control Consideration

For some, hormonal birth control might be a viable option to regulate cycles. Discussing this with a healthcare professional offered insights into potential benefits and considerations.
